Output d66c7e7f635ae09efd2e55b8874f8a8cb29f230d8bb5dfd032affa1725c22a58:0

value
85310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5cbaf324311367b71883532c375928e92c11276 OP_EQUALVERIFY OP_CHECKSIG
address
1K2r82dTUEWpoVGLi3GcRURiZsBcar7b8D
transaction
d66c7e7f635ae09efd2e55b8874f8a8cb29f230d8bb5dfd032affa1725c22a58
confirmations
507847
spent
true